掌握SQL Server 2000 ODBC数据源连接技巧
版权申诉
82 浏览量
更新于2024-10-10
收藏 15KB RAR 举报
资源摘要信息:"ODBC的数据源连接是指利用ODBC(Open Database Connectivity)技术实现应用程序与数据库管理系统之间的连接。ODBC是一种数据库访问方式,它允许应用程序以统一的方式访问多种数据库,无论数据库使用的是何种数据库管理系统。对于SQL Server 2000来说,ODBC为数据库用户提供了便利的访问方式,使得开发者能够通过ODBC驱动与SQL Server 2000数据库进行通信。
描述中提到的ODBC数据源连接特别适用于使用SQL Server 2000的数据库用户。SQL Server 2000是微软公司的一款关系型数据库管理系统,它需要通过适当的连接设置才能被应用程序访问。ODBC作为一种数据库访问接口标准,提供了一种基于SQL的数据库访问能力,它允许开发者用标准的SQL语句来操作数据库。
在使用ODBC时,需要配置数据源名称(DSN),DSN是一个包含了数据库连接信息的配置文件,它保存了数据库服务器的位置、数据库名称、认证信息等。通过设置ODBC DSN,用户可以指定连接到的数据库类型和具体服务器,以及如何进行认证。在Windows操作系统中,可以通过"控制面板"中的"管理工具"里的"数据源(ODBC)"进行配置。
ODBC连接过程一般包括以下几个步骤:
1. 安装ODBC驱动程序:必须确保客户端安装了对应数据库系统的ODBC驱动程序,例如针对SQL Server 2000的ODBC驱动。
2. 配置DSN:设置数据源名称,包括选择数据库驱动、填写服务器名称、输入数据库名称、提供登录用户名和密码等。
3. 测试连接:配置完成后,通常需要进行测试,确保设置的DSN能够成功连接到数据库。
4. 编写和执行SQL语句:一旦连接成功,就可以通过ODBC API编写SQL语句,并执行相应的数据库操作。
在软件开发中,ODBC常用于开发跨平台的应用程序,因为它提供了一种不依赖于特定数据库厂商的数据库访问方法。开发者通过ODBC API可以编写出与数据库无关的代码,只要相应的数据库管理系统提供了ODBC驱动,就可以使用统一的代码访问不同的数据库。
对于SQL Server 2000来说,开发者通常会使用ODBC来实现以下操作:
- 查询数据(SELECT)
- 更新数据(UPDATE)
- 删除数据(DELETE)
- 插入数据(INSERT)
- 执行存储过程
- 管理数据库对象,比如表、视图、索引等
通过ODBC,开发者可以使用统一的编程接口来操作SQL Server 2000数据库,这在需要同时支持多种数据库系统的企业级应用中尤其有用。同时,ODBC也支持多种编程语言,如C/C++、Java、Python等,使得开发者能够在不同语言环境下,利用ODBC实现数据库操作。
此外,为了优化性能,ODBC还提供了一些高级特性,例如连接池、游标控制等,这些特性可以在一定程度上提升数据库操作的效率。但是,ODBC作为传统的数据库访问方式,其性能往往不及一些新的、专用的数据库访问接口,如***(针对.NET应用)或者专用的ORM(对象关系映射)工具。
在文件压缩包中,名为"ODBC.doc"的文件可能包含更具体的关于ODBC配置和使用方法的信息。这份文档可能详细介绍了如何安装和配置SQL Server 2000的ODBC驱动程序、如何创建和管理DSN,以及如何通过ODBC API编写数据库访问代码。对于数据库管理员和开发人员来说,这份文档将是实现和管理ODBC数据源连接的重要资源。"
2020-07-24 上传
2022-09-22 上传
2022-09-23 上传
2022-09-23 上传
2021-08-11 上传
2022-09-23 上传
2022-09-24 上传
2022-09-14 上传
2022-09-14 上传
朱moyimi
- 粉丝: 75
- 资源: 1万+
最新资源
- 深入浅出:自定义 Grunt 任务的实践指南
- 网络物理突变工具的多点路径规划实现与分析
- multifeed: 实现多作者间的超核心共享与同步技术
- C++商品交易系统实习项目详细要求
- macOS系统Python模块whl包安装教程
- 掌握fullstackJS:构建React框架与快速开发应用
- React-Purify: 实现React组件纯净方法的工具介绍
- deck.js:构建现代HTML演示的JavaScript库
- nunn:现代C++17实现的机器学习库开源项目
- Python安装包 Acquisition-4.12-cp35-cp35m-win_amd64.whl.zip 使用说明
- Amaranthus-tuberculatus基因组分析脚本集
- Ubuntu 12.04下Realtek RTL8821AE驱动的向后移植指南
- 掌握Jest环境下的最新jsdom功能
- CAGI Toolkit:开源Asterisk PBX的AGI应用开发
- MyDropDemo: 体验QGraphicsView的拖放功能
- 远程FPGA平台上的Quartus II17.1 LCD色块闪烁现象解析